**CI note: Garage occupancy feed (Stallhaven SDK).** Plugin authors: if your CI run fails on the occupancy-feed contract test, the mock garage fixture likely lags the schema by one version. Regenerate fixtures before retrying; stale counts cause false negatives. Validate your plugin against the reference build identified by the token below.

trace token, bawef-hagug: htk14_86959b54a07f99

Finance Review Summary — Insurance Renewal

Quick rundown for you: Meridell Fabrication's property and liability policies renew next quarter, and our broker flagged a likely 12% premium bump, mostly tied to the Ashgrove warehouse expansion. We've pushed back and expect a counteroffer within two weeks. Nothing alarming, but worth watching. The strategic context for the renewal decision appears in the note below.

internal memo for hahif-hahaf: Headcount on the Zorwyn team goes from 9 to 100 by the end of October. Gross margin on Zorwyn came in at 5 percent against a plan of 10 percent.

## Tune ingestion limits for the Lampwick crash-report pipeline

This PR adjusts how the mobile crash reporter batches and uploads minidumps. Context for newcomers: reports are queued on-device, compressed, and flushed either on a timer or when the batch fills. Oversized payloads were previously dropped silently; they are now truncated with a marker so the backend can flag them. Symbolication retries are also capped to protect the worker pool. The revised constants are as follows.

tuning constants:
QUOTAS = {
    "druwyn": 5,
    "holix": 5,
    "zorath": 5,
    "holwyn": 10,
}

Eng sync notes, Pedalshift rebalancing tool. Demand model retrained; dock-level forecasts improved ~12% in backtests. Truck-routing solver still times out on the Harrowby zone — workaround caps zone size. Ops dashboard shipped; alerts pending. Open items: nightly batch overlaps with dock inventory sync, causing stale counts; fix scoped for next sprint. Decision: freeze new features until solver stability lands. All questions on the rebalancing roadmap go to the owner identified below.

account owner for fajep-yagef: Kasix Eliiel